Exploring Slots Not on GamStop

GamStop is a self-exclusion scheme designed for UK individuals who wish to restrict their access to UKGC-licensed gambling sites. When players register with GamStop, they cannot access any gaming venue holding a UK Gambling Commission licence for their chosen exclusion period. However, this restriction only affects operators regulated by British regulators, allowing overseas sites outside this system available to UK users seeking alternative gaming venues.

International gaming platforms operate under licenses from jurisdictions such as Curacao, Malta, or Gibraltar, meaning they fall outside GamStop’s reach. Top International Licensing Regulatory Bodies for Slots Not on GamStop

When reviewing offshore casino platforms, grasping the credibility of global regulatory bodies becomes essential for UK players. Trustworthy regulatory regions maintain strict regulatory frameworks that guarantee fair play conditions, protected payment processing, and player protection mechanisms. These licensing bodies conduct regular audits, apply technical standards, and offer dispute resolution services that preserve your interests as a player.

The leading international regulators have established decades-long reputations for maintaining strict quality standards. Malta Gaming Authority, Curacao eGaming, and the Gibraltar Regulatory Authority are top-tier licensing bodies that UK players can trust. Each jurisdiction offers particular benefits to casino supervision, from strict regulatory requirements to streamlined licensing processes that appeal to quality operators.

Licensing Authority Jurisdiction Established Key Strengths
Malta Gaming Authority (MGA) Malta, EU 2001 Rigorous compliance standards, EU-based regulation, extensive player safeguards
Curacao eGaming Curacao 1996 Flexible licensing framework, quick approval process, economical for operators
Gibraltar Regulatory Authority Gibraltar 1998 Strong financial oversight, British Overseas Territory, transparent regulations
Kahnawake Gaming Commission Canada 1996 Longstanding reputation, North American base, established dispute resolution
Anjouan Gaming License Comoros 2005 Easy-to-obtain licenses, expanding operator base, developing regulatory framework

Verifying a gaming license credentials should be your initial action before registration. Legitimate operators display their license number prominently in website footers, with verification seals linking directly to the regulator’s validation page. Verify these details on the licensing authority’s official website to verify legitimacy and check for any sanctions or warnings against the operator.

Are slots not on GamStop permitted for UK gamblers to use?

Yes, it is legal for UK players to access and play at international gaming sites that function beyond the UK Gambling Commission’s jurisdiction. These platforms are licensed from international regulatory bodies such as the Malta Gaming Authority, Curacao eGaming, or the Gibraltar Regulatory Authority. While these gaming sites are not registered with GamStop and don’t hold UKGC licenses, they function within legal frameworks under their respective jurisdictions. UK law does not prevent players from using gambling services provided by operators licensed in other countries. However, players should recognize that these sites fall outside the safeguards provided by UK gambling regulations, including complaint resolution mechanisms and the Financial Ombudsman Service.
